Output d523d9600220a367452028146c4e2a56c5fff15b64e552460986f929f8db7cd8:0

value
71571
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b606e948018b026955a5e5ed6046539a08f48c23 OP_EQUAL
address
3JHVBfC9r5J7eNxA5L2vKshQNtTtmkqStU
transaction
d523d9600220a367452028146c4e2a56c5fff15b64e552460986f929f8db7cd8
spent
true